Abstract

The invention discloses a check valve of a compressor. The check valve consists of a jointed shaft mounted on the member forming a spitting hole or a valve base, a valve board using the jointed shaft as central rotation and a elastomer connected on the valve board to regulate the rotation of the valve board. The check valve is used for compressing gas and spitting hole for spitting compressed gas of the compression member. It can reduce the valve-opening and-closing noise when the check valve is working.

Background technique
Compressor is used for compression work gas to improve the machine of its pressure for passing on power from power generating apparatus such as motor or turbines and exerting pressure to working gas.It is used widely in whole industrial field, and is divided into the compressor of multiple modes such as reciprocating type, Scroll, turbo type according to the mode of its compression work gas.But most of compressor is irrelevant and all have and exert pressure and the press part of compression work gas with the mode of compression work gas, and the structure that the working gas that compresses in the press part is discharged to discharge portion by tap hole.
But, when quit work or the improper situation of operating conditions under, the pressure of the working gas of press part will be lower than discharge portion and the working gas adverse current that makes discharge in press part, and then cause the reduction of compression efficiency by expanding again of working gas.
For this reason, the pressurized gas exhaust port of compressor is equipped with reverse stop valve, is used to prevent to discharge under the above-mentioned situation adverse current phenomenon of gas.In the compressor of prior art, reverse stop valve when work, will produce the valve opening and closing noise and reduce the reliability of compressor.
Below with reference to the interpolation drawing and with the scroll compressor is the problems referred to above that example describes reverse stop valve in the prior art in detail.Fig. 1 points out out the profile diagram of the scroll compressor in the prior art, and Fig. 2 points out out the longitudinal plane part expanded view of the scroll compressor in the prior art.
As shown in the figure, the scroll compressor in the prior art 100 is formed the casing 110 of confined space by inside; Be arranged at the inside of casing 110, be used for the compression mechanical part 130 of compression refrigerant; The mechanism portion 120 of driving force is provided for compression mechanical part 130; Respectively be arranged at the upper and lower sides of mechanism portion 120, the main frame 114 of the running shaft 123 of rotatable support mechanism portion 120 and auxiliary frame 115 etc. are partly formed.Compression mechanical part 130 is made up of following several sections: be provided with the fixedly volume 133 of involute shape, and central authorities connect and to be formed for discharging the tap hole 137 of compression refrigerant, and be fixedly set in the fixedly spool 131 in the inside upper part field of casing 110; Be provided with the rotation volume 134 of assisting to form the involute shape of refrigerant compression volumes with fixing volume 133 mutually, and be incorporated into the eccentric part 124 of running shaft 123, relative movement simultaneously is in fixing spool 131 and the spinning reel 132 of compression refrigerant.
In addition, fixedly spool 131 is provided with reverse stop valve assemblying body 140, is used to prevent the working gas of the compression of discharging by tap hole 137, the adverse current phenomenon under situation such as quit work.Simultaneously, fixedly also be provided with dividing plate 118 on the spool 131, be used for that inside with casing 110 is divided into high pressure side and low voltage side and fix along the fixing upside outer circumferential face of spool 131.The upside of dividing plate 118 is provided with and discharge hides 150, discharges to hide 150 and be provided with the certain containing space that is used to reduce the coolant noise of discharging by reverse stop valve assemblying body 140, runs through upside simultaneously and is communicated in top and hides 112 inside.
Reverse stop valve assemblying body 140 is by being used to open and close the fixedly valve plates 141 of the tap hole 137 of spool 131, and the retainer etc. that is used for control valve door-plate 141 open amounts is partly formed.Undeclared symbol 125 is oil strainers in the drawing, the 127th, and the bearing shell lining; Sleeve pipe, 135 is axle sleeve.
In the scroll compressor of prior art, power supply by addition, to produce magnetic field between the stator 121 of electric motor portion 120 and the gyrator 122, perforation be incorporated into rotation gyrator 122 centers running shaft 123 will with gyrator 122 interlocks, and the spinning reel 132 that is incorporated into gyrator 122 eccentric parts 124 is rotatablely moved, thereby will be drawn into by the working gas that suction pipe 116 is drawn into the low pressure of low voltage section between the fixedly volume 133 and rotation volume 134 of the fixedly spool 131 that is meshed and spinning reel 132, with its compression and by fixedly tap hole 137 discharges of spool 131.
When compressor operating, the working gas in the pressing chamber is in high pressure conditions, and makes upwards lateral bending Qu Bingxiang discharge covering 150 sides discharge pressurized gas of valve plates 141.When the pressure that is caused working gas in the pressing chamber P by reason such as quit work reduces, valve plates 141 will be blocked tap hole and prevent to discharge the phenomenon of gas to pressing chamber P adverse current.
But the reverse stop valve 140 in the prior art is when opening and closing valve, and valve plates 141 will clash into the retainer 142 or the fixing top and generation impact noise of spool 131.Noise then hides 112 to the outside radiation by top, thereby increases the operating noise of compressor and can't ensure the quiet working environment of compressor.
Summary of the invention
For make the compressor that solves in the prior art with reverse stop valve when the valve opening and closing, impact other parts by valve plates and produce the problem of noise, the object of the present invention is to provide, the function of reverse stop valve that prevents to discharge back flow of gas with compressor can realize that noise when significantly reducing reverse stop valve opens and closes is to ensure the compressor reverse stop valve of quiet working environment simultaneously.
In order to achieve the above object, be provided with the press part that is used for pressurized gas, and the compressor that is used for discharging the tap hole of compressing section compresses gas, the compressor among the present invention is made up of following structure with reverse stop valve: hinging shaft; With the hinging shaft is the valve plates of center rotation; Be connected in the parts such as elastomer that valve plates is used to regulate above-mentioned valve plates rotation, and as feature.
Wherein, hinging shaft can be fixed on the member that forms above-mentioned tap hole, also can be fixed on the valve support that is close to tap hole.When hinging shaft opens and closes at reverse stop valve, the central shaft that will rotatablely move as valve plates, and constitute by the rod shape of metal material, so that have the stiffness of the pressure that can bear pressurized gas.
Valve plates will be central shaft rotation with the hinging shaft, and the rotation by valve plates opens and closes the reverse stop valve among the present invention.That is, valve plates rotatablely moves and clings on tap hole or the valve support, nips off the pressurized gas stream thus and reverse stop valve is in closed condition.
In addition, elastomer is used to connect valve plates and valve support, or connects valve plates and valve plates rotating amount and the rotational speed with the modulating valve door-plate.Be to carry out regulatory function, elastomer reverse stop valve in the present invention needs gravitation and repulsion all to act on the valve plates when opening and closing, thereby uses member such as line spring more suitable.
According to as above structure, the pressure difference of the upper and lower sides working gas by valve plates and the weight of valve plates self will rotation movement of valve door-plates and prevented to discharge the adverse current phenomenon of working gas when opening and closing reverse stop valve among the present invention.At this moment, elastomer is with the rotating amount of mediation valve door-plate and reduce rotational speed, so the valve opening and closing noise that produces can reduce the reverse stop valve work of compressor in the prior art time.
The effect of invention: as above described in detail, the elastomeric gravitation of the present invention by being connected in valve plates and the pressure of the working gas of valve plates upper and lower sides, make valve plates open and close tap hole and prevented that compressor from discharging the adverse current of gas, have the function that the adverse current that prevents pressurized gas causes expansion-loss again.Simultaneously, when valve plates is closed, to valve plates be diminished with the area that valve support or other member contact, and the rotating amount and the rotational speed of the elastomer modulating valve door-plate by being connected in above-mentioned valve plates, can significantly reduce the impact noise that reverse stop valve when work of compressor in the prior art produces thus, and realize the quiet working environment of compressor simultaneously.In addition, by reverse stop valve of the present invention is used on the compressor, in prior art, hide and not to have the necessity that is provided with, make when volume that need the minimizing compressor to reach favourable effect for reduce discharging discharge that noise is arranged at the tap hole upside of compressor.

Embodiment
Aforesaid formation of the present invention and effect will obtain more detailed description by next example.The example that will illustrate is to include the example of valve support as constituting component below, by this example, can find easily that of the present invention constituting do not include above-mentioned valve support, and hinging shaft is fixed in member rather than the valve support that forms tap hole.Below with reference to adding the example that drawing describes the scroll compressor that has adopted the reverse stop valve among the present invention in detail.
Fig. 3 points out out the profile diagram of the scroll compressor that includes reverse stop valve of the present invention.Fig. 4 points out out the expansion institute diagrammatic sketch of the reverse stop valve among the present invention.Fig. 5 points out out the longitudinal plane expanded view of the reverse stop valve of the present invention that includes the valve support that does not form section poor face.Fig. 6 points out out the longitudinal plane expanded view of the reverse stop valve of the present invention that includes the valve support that forms section difference face.
As shown in Figure 3, the scroll compressor that includes the reverse stop valve among the present invention is made up of following structure: the inner casing 10 that forms confined space; Be arranged at the inside of casing 10, be used for the compression mechanical part 30 of compression work gas; The electric motor portion 20 of driving force is provided for compression mechanical part 30; Respectively be arranged at the upper and lower sides of electric motor portion 20, and the main frame 14 and the auxiliary frame 15 of the running shaft 23 of rotatable support electric motor portion 20.
Compression mechanical part 30 is made of fixedly spool 31 and spinning reel 32, and fixedly spool 31 is fixedly set in the upper area of casing 10 inside, and is provided with central authorities and connects the tap hole 37 that is used to discharge compression refrigerant that forms.32 relative movement of spinning reel are in fixing spool 31 and compression refrigerant.Fixedly the upside of spool 31 is provided with to discharge and hides 50, discharges and hides the inner accepting space that is formed with sealing in 50, the noise that produces when being used to reduce by tap hole 37 discharge gases.
Simultaneously, fixedly tap hole 37 upsides of spool 31 are provided with and are used to prevent the working gas of having discharged the reverse stop valve of the present invention 60 to pressing chamber P adverse current.
As shown in Figure 4, reverse stop valve 60 of the present invention includes valve support 61; Be fixed in the hinging shaft 62 of valve support 61; With hinging shaft 62 is the valve plates 63 of center rotation; Be connected in the parts such as line spring 64 of valve plates and modulating valve door-plate rotation.
The drum of 61 one-tenth hollows of valve support also is incorporated into the upper end of tap hole 37, and its associated methods is fixing more suitable for welding.Valve support 61 is used for fixing hinging shaft 62, and plays the effect that the guiding working gas flows.As Fig. 4 and shown in Figure 5, valve support 61 is generally formed by the drum of hollow.But under the situation that general hollow cylinder shape forms, the seal when closing for guarantee reverse stop valve 60 of the present invention, reverse stop valve 60 of the present invention need precision machining when making.For making reverse stop valve 60 of the present invention make upward convenient and improving its airtight degree, as shown in Figure 6, will on the hollow cylinder inner peripheral surface 61a of valve support 61, form a section poor face 61b.
Hinging shaft 62 is made of the rod shape of metal material, and is fixed in valve support 61 with cylinder cross section diameter of a circle direction, simultaneously the central shaft that rotatablely moves as valve plates 63.
Valve plates 63 is made of the plate of 2 semi-circular shapes of metal material, and 2 semi-circular shape plates link to each other by hinging shaft 62 in the straight line angle part of its each semi-circular plate, is that central shaft rotatablely moves and opens and closes reverse stop valve 60 of the present invention thus with hinging shaft 62 simultaneously.The two ends of line spring 64 respectively are connected on the valve plates 63 of 2 semi-circular shapes, and are used for the rotating amount and the rotational speed of modulating valve door-plate 63.When line spring 64 is closed at above-mentioned reverse stop valve 60, will apply gravitation so that valve plates 63 is slowly closed to valve plates 63; When reverse stop valve 60 is opened, then valve plates 63 is applied repulsion and produce noise to prevent 2 valve plates 63 from bumping against.
The following describes the as above effect of the example of the present invention of structure, reverse stop valve 60 of the present invention is before compressor starts work, shown in the expanded view in the left circles among Fig. 5, under the state that the gravity of the gravitation of online spring 64 and valve plates 63 own wt correspondences balances each other, 2 valve plates 63 will be formed centrally 120 ° to 180 ° obtuse angle in will being with hinging shaft 62.Above-mentioned 2 valve plates 63 form the former of obtuse angles because when the pressure of the gas that waits and discharge when quitting work is higher than pressure in the pressing chamber P, the pressure of discharge gas will act on the upside of valve plates 63 and cut-off valve door-plate 63.When compressor starts is worked, the working gas of pressing chamber P mesohigh will flow into tap hole 37, shown in the expanded view in the medial side circle among Fig. 5,2 valve plates 63 will be subjected to the pressure of pressurized gas and upwards folding, thereby make 60 one-tenth open states of reverse stop valve of the present invention and discharge the working gas of high pressure to discharging covering 50.
Simultaneously, be discharged to when quitting work by compressor etc. and discharge the pressure that hides the working gas in 50 when being higher than pressing chamber P pressure inside, the gravity of the weight correspondence of valve plates 63 self, and discharge the force action that hides the pressure difference of working gas in 50 interior working gass and the pressing chamber P then launch up to reaching balance with line spring 64 gravitation with joint efforts always in 63,2 valve plates 62 of 2 valve plates.Here, the suitable elasticity coefficient k value of selection wire spring 64, shown in the expanded view in the right circles among Fig. 5,2 valve plates 63 are 180 ° of angles of center generate with hinging shaft 62, make when being close to the inner peripheral surface 61a of valve support 61, make a concerted effort to reach balance with the gravitation of line spring 64.At this moment, reverse stop valve 60 will be closed to prevent discharging back flow of gas in pressing chamber.Because valve plates 63 is less with the area that valve support 61 contacts, isochrone spring 64 can reduce the rotating amount and the rotational speed of valve plates 63, so can significantly reduce the valve opening and closing noise.Just, for realizing the airtight of reverse stop valve 60 of the present invention, valve plates 63 and valve support 61 be precision machining to greatest extent, or be adjacent to the packing ring of being close to the rubber material on valve plates 63 circumferential surfacies of valve support 61 inner peripheral surface 61a, make the interval between 2 semicircle valve plates 63 and the valve support inner peripheral surface 61a reach minimum.
But when making valve plates 63 and valve support 61, precision machining will need a lot of expenses.Shown in the expanded view in the circle among Fig. 6, if the inner peripheral surface 61a of valve support 61 forms section difference face 61b and constitutes, when situation that valve plates 63 is closed, valve plates 63 and section difference face 61b will dock and make reverse stop valve 60 airtight, thereby need not precision machining valve plates 63 and valve support 61, the making of reverse stop valve 60 of the present invention is more prone to.At this moment, can imagine valve plates 63 will clash into above-mentioned section poor face 61b and produce impact noise, but as mentioned above, when valve plates 63 is launched and close reverse stop valve 60 of the present invention, line spring 64 will reduce the rotating amount and the rotational speed of valve plates 63, make the speed of valve plates 63 contact-segment difference face 61b not too large, its impact noise also reduces immediately.Simultaneously, shown in the expanded view in the circle among Fig. 6, when the noise of being close to formations such as rubber material on the section difference face 61b of valve support 61 prevents member 65, its impact noise will further reduce.
The effect of the reverse stop valve of scroll compressor in the effect of comparison reverse stop valve 60 examples of the present invention and the prior art below.
As shown in Figure 2, the scroll compressor in the prior art is equipped with the flexible valve plates 141 of above-below direction, and opens and closes reverse stop valve according to its working state, makes valve plates 141 bump retainers 142 or fixing spool 131 top and produce impact noise.
But, as Fig. 5 and shown in Figure 6, when reverse stop valve 60 is in the present invention closed, valve plates 63 is contacted with valve support 61 or other area of members diminishes, and, significantly reduced the impact noise that produces when reverse stop valve 60 opens and closes thus by line spring 64 suitable rotating amount and the rotational speeies that reduce valve plates 63.
